⭐ About the Role

As a  Research Director , you will step into a strategic leadership position where you will guide high-value, qualitative-leaning healthcare research from end to end. You’ll be responsible for elevating the thinking, the approach, and the delivery of insight across your team and the organisation.

This role is ideal for someone who wants to  lead, influence, and shape  the research offering — without the pressures of business development or sales targets.

What You’ll Lead & Deliver

  Strategic Insight Leadership

  • Drive high-level research design, methodological thinking, and framing of strategic questions.

  • Push beyond surface-level insight to uncover what truly matters for patients, clinicians, and commercial teams.

  Team Leadership & Development

  • Lead, mentor, and elevate a talented team of qualitative and strategic researchers.

  • Model best-in-class qualitative practice, from study design to moderation to storytelling.

  • Champion a culture of growth, learning, and open collaboration.

  Quality-Focused Research Execution

  • Ensure each project is crafted thoughtfully — quality over quantity is the standard, not the exception.

  • Oversee the delivery of rigorous, meaningful qualitative work that informs clinical and commercial strategy.

  • Provide senior oversight, moderation, and strategic interpretation where needed.

  Cross-Functional & Client Collaboration

  • Work closely with internal teams to ensure alignment, clarity, and excellence across all stages of research.

  • Engage with clients as a trusted advisor — helping shape the questions, connect the dots, and present compelling insight narratives.

  No Business Development Pressure

  • Your focus is leading research and delivering excellence — not selling or chasing revenue.

  • Growth comes naturally through the quality of the team’s work and long-standing client relationships.

What You Bring

  • Strong experience in  qualitative or mixed-method healthcare research , with a strategic lens

  • Demonstrated ability to  lead teams , elevate thinking, and guide complex studies

  • Expertise in qualitative research design, moderation, synthesis, and storytelling

  • A mindset that values  rigor, clarity, and meaningful outcomes over volume

  • Strong communication skills with the ability to influence stakeholders at all levels

  • A collaborative leadership style and a deep commitment to high-quality, human-centered insight
